Animal Super Squad jumping on to Xbox One next year

Console version of physics based adventure game allows audiences to participate.

Animal Super Squad is a physics-based adventure game that lets you play as your favorite animal (if your favorite animal is either a chicken, a fish, or a sloth). Speed through a world full of dangers and bananas, create your own levels, share them with the community, or forget all that nonsense and just play other people’s stuff.

Created by DoubleMoose Games, the development studio co-founded by Goat Simulator designer Armin Ibrisagic, and already available for iOS, Android, PS4, Nintendo Switch, and PC, Animal Super Squad brings its unique blend of wacky acrobatics and fast-paced platforming to Xbox One.

Whether racing through vibrant campaign stages or creating and sharing levels of your own, you’ll need to dodge spikes, fight bosses, solve puzzles, and collect bananas as your favorite fauna, boosting through loops, over gaps, and out of cannons. The Xbox One version will feature exclusive Mixer interactivity, giving audiences the opportunity to participate in games as they’re being broadcast over the live-streaming service.

  • Choose from a variety of vehicles, each with different controls
  • Multiple items to unlock
  • Community-driven level editor, make and share levels for endless replayability
  • Physics-based gameplay
  • Broadcast via Mixer, let your audience interact and get involved with the action

 

Animal Super Squad is available on Steam now, priced at £7.19 / $9.99 / €9.99, and will be launching on Xbox One on the 1st of February next year.
